Josias gives Romualdo a gaze of astonishment. He had no intention of asking just in the construction site, but the opportunity came and he would not refuse. He just didn't expect to get this easy. Was Everaldo in action again?
“Are you sure, sir? Here it looks like work done with care. I don't have a lot of construction experience; at most I helped as Uélton is doing.”
Romualdo analyzes Josias's physical constitution from him. Because he was shirtless, it became easier. “You don't look like a fragile boy to me. You're not muscular, but I see a little strength in your arms and shoulders.”
“I was never an idle person, or a sedentary person, as they say,” Josias explains, with a proud smile.
“Then there is no more talk!” Romualdo sentences, “If you really want to, come tomorrow to start. And what you don't know how to do, we'll teach you. What do you say?”
What to say? Of course, Josias would not refuse! “I accept, Seu Romualdo.”
“Smart boy, you already got my name.” Romualdo smiles widely. The two shake hands to seal the deal. “If you want, you can start tomorrow. And I suggest that you come with another more suitable outfit.”
Josias turns red just to remember. “This will not be possible, Seu Romualdo.”
Romualdo frowns. “Huh, why not? You don't plan on coming in pajamas, do you? I can even pass up the fact that you are shirtless because of the heat, but I would wear these pants in cold weather.”
“It's just that I'm in such a critical situation that this outfit is all I have left.” Josias decides to explain without going into too much detail, “I was forced, so to speak, to leave the house like that.”
Romualdo puts his hand on his chin. “Did you run away for doing some illegal stuff, boy?”
Josias needed to deal with that question. Unfortunately, that's what people think. It is rare to find a young man who is not doing something wrong with each passing year.
Josias only had to deny it. “No, I swear. If I was messing with the wrong thing, I wouldn't be looking for some honest occupation right now.”
Romualdo smiles again and relieves himself. Smart answer. The boy doesn't sleep on the spot.
“Tomorrow, at eight in the morning. Can I know your name?”
“Josias Rocha.” Josias pronounces his name as if he were an authority.
After final greetings, Josias returns to Teodoro's building, almost jumping with happiness. When he passes a house whose radio played “Working My Way Back to You”, by The Spinners, he even dances in the middle of the main street.
Upon entering the reception, Teodoro finds the boy all smiling. “Don't tell me that you found something to do in this place. No, wait! Did you find the girl, find out where she lives?”
Josias burst out laughing. “Not yet, Seu Teodoro, but I found what I was looking for! I managed to get some occupation! Now I'm going to pay for the little room, you can rest easy.”
Teodoro is already fond of Josias enough to go out from behind the counter to embrace the boy. Josias became for him like a nephew. When the two leave, he says, “Don't worry about rent. Next month we’ll see that. When you receive your first payment, focus on buying things for yourself.”
“He told me to go in another outfit.” Josias starts to laugh, “But it seems that these sweatpants will be used. I am not going to use new pants to move cement.”
Teodoro raises an eyebrow. “Cement? Are you going to work at a construction site?”
“Yeah,” Josias quickly adds, “and you can undo that face of worry, Seu Teodoro. I am no weakling, despite my age. I’ve helped you a few times, it’s not that difficult. And Seu Romualdo seems to me to be good people, what I don't know he teaches me.”
“I hope so. I know Romualdo, he is well requested in the locality for construction. Do you know the bathrooms here? He did it. If I had met him before, I would have him build the entire building.”
Josias smiles in agreement. He realized that the bathroom was built more carefully than the rest of the building. It was probably not Romualdo who built those houses on the main street.
After that, Josias went to his room, satisfied and thanking God mentally for another stage of his life resolved. Now it was time to start work, save money and use it wisely. Josias could even make a list of priorities, but he had no notebook or pen.
